Secretion of Protein by the Submandibular Glands of the Rat, Mouse, and Hamster in Response to Various Parasympatho- and Sympatho-mimetic Drugs
K. Abe
Department of Oral Biochemistry, Gifu College of Dentistry, Gifu, Japan
C. Dawes
Department of Oral Biology, Faculty of Dentistry, University of Manitoba, Winnipeg, Canada R3E OW3
The types of proteins secreted by the submandibular glands of rats in response to high doses of -adrenergic agonists are electrophoretically different from those secreted in response to cholinergic and β-adrenergic agonists, but, in mice and hamsters, they appear to be independent of the nature of the stimulus.
